Securing the Sun Fire 12K/15K Domains

by Alex Noordergraaf, Steven Spadaccini, and Dina Nimeh
January, 2004

This article documents security modifications that you can implement on Sun Fire 12K and 15K domains without adversely affecting their behavior. The configuration changes in this article enable Solaris Operating Environment (OE) security features and disable potentially insecure services and daemons. This article is one in a series that provides recommendations for enhancing security of a Sun Fire system. Before securing the domains, we recommend that you use the "Securing the Sun Fire 12K and 15K System Controllers" article to secure the system controllers. This article includes updates related to System Management Services (SMS) version 1.4.
